Output e619753c02dcbd342f3b34f46424a6ac726674e97074804bc64ba6b14970416f:5

value
1529416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e6148efb19132ba3fad9701623f3d94b87848ef OP_EQUAL
address
38qTAypJoY5hns2sYvMfjcWCbJwpsCdLNe
transaction
e619753c02dcbd342f3b34f46424a6ac726674e97074804bc64ba6b14970416f
confirmations
106963
spent
true